  • Ask HN: What is your favourite stocks/options trading platform?
    You didn't ask the country so my answers might slightly differ 1. India - Kite by Zerodha[0]. Zero brokerage fees (!) for equity delivery. INR 20 for options. Easy to understand UI and great community 2. Australia - Superhero [1]. Zero brokerage for buying ETFs. Easy app but given my infrequent usage (once a month) not really a problem.
